利用 Oracle 切换日志组实现数据库高可用(oracle切换日志组)

Oracle 是一款高性能的数据库管理系统,是应用于从简单的数据存储系统到一种可实现高可用性的企业级数据库系统,满足企业组织中多种不同业务需求的 Springbean 必备强大功能。Oracle 数据库高可用性实现存储负载分离,分片存储。它可以有助于降低成本,减少故障导致的停机时间,减少企业停止运营的风险,并不断提高企业的数据库运行稳定性和安全性。其中最常用的方式是利用 Oracle 切换日志组实现数据库高可用性。

Oracle 切换日志组(also known as Logging On Standby)通过启用 Oracle 日志切换特性来实现数据库高可用性。切换日志组有助于实现备库和主库之间的双向复制功能,这样可以在备库中运行一个任务,而主库中的日志会自动传输到备库中。如果主库发生故障,系统就会自动将备库提升为主库,从而确保数据库可用性。

首先,应将两台数据库服务器搭建成一个 Oracle 高可用性体系,将备库重命名为活动的主库,并调用 Oracle Data Guard 功能启用备库。此时,在主库上运行的操作都将自动开始备份到备库中。

然后,配置两台服务器上的 Oracle 库之间的日志切换,以实现备库和主库之间的双向复制功能,实现 Oracle 备库提升功能。配置完成后,当主库发生故障时,会自动将备库提升为主库,从而改变服务器的数据库状态,使数据库运行状态变成高可用性。

此外,Oracle 还可以通过反向复制来实现高可用,即从备库复制到主库,从而实现在两台数据库服务器上的数据内容持续性同步。当主库因故障而失去服务时,备库会自动提升为主库,同时,通过反向复制可以实现从备库提升为主库后,数据库服务器之间数据的及时同步。

通过 Oracle 切换日志组实现的数据库高可用性,可以帮助企业有效降低大规模的维护和管理成本,有效提高 IT 系统的稳定性,使企业数据和应用系统能得到及时有效的保护。


数据运维技术 » 利用 Oracle 切换日志组实现数据库高可用(oracle切换日志组)